Hmmm. BB were awfully good in '06 when the sets merged and first Dale and then Buzz joined them onstage at the end of their opening set to form the first live incarnation of Big Belvins. Those shows were amazing. But yeah, Le Butcherettes were incredible, might be the most fun I've had watching an opening band who wasn't, uh, also in the band? hmm.

In '03 when Dalek opened, Kevin and Dale came out and played with them on their last song, and I think Buzz came out eventually too (memory's a little foggy) They made alot of noise,  Kevin had on some kind of s&m mask and Dale was in his lingerie. They just got louder and noisier as the dj pretty much destroyed his tuntables. That was pretty cool. First time seeing both, and became an instant Dalek fan.
